It was just a clinical error
Following on from last edition’s tales about similar- sounding French words... while living in the Gers I visited a clinic in Auch.
The surgeon said I would be admitted at 8am next day ‘a jeun’. I said, “I can’t be in Agen by that time as I live in Marciac.”
